Red Men To Face Hornets in Home Opener

Following a week of training back on the lakefront, and a weeklong trip in Texas, the Carthage College Red Men (1-0, 0-0 College Conference of Illinois and Wisconsin) will host their home opener against the Hornets of Kalamazoo College (1-0, 0-0 Michigan Intercollegiate Athletic Conference). This will mark the first home match for the Red Men on the newly renovated Art Keller Field.


LAST TIME OUT

  • Red Men opened the 2017 season with a 7-1 win versus Dallas Christian College in Dallas, Tex.

  • Five Red Men scored in the season opener, two of which were from returning sophomore Freddy Martinez, and freshman Kevin Reilly.

  • Martinez also added three assists to his stat sheet, which is tied for the second most in a single game performance.

  • The Friday match marked the return for juniors Niko Mavrogiannis and Kevin Mahoney following premature season ending injuries in 2016. Mavrogiannis collected 1 save in the match.

  • The Red Men were without the services of Johnny Rimkus, Adrian Herrera, Jeff Montemayor, and Brayan Justiniano due to illness.


SCOUTING THE HORNETS

  • The Hornets finished 2016 with a 6-6-5 record, finishing fifth in the MIAA.

  • The 2017 season captains are seniors Griffin Hamel, Antonio Pisto, and Jonathan Nord.

  • Kalamazoo College currently stands at a 1-0 record following their season opening win against Milikin University.

  • The Hornets defeated the Big Blue by a score of 2-1 with goals from freshmen Ryan Melgar and Bobby Dennerll.

  • Senior goalkeeper Hamel made 10 saves in the season opening match.

  • The Hornets maintain a 1-0 record against the Red Men following a 2-0 decision in 2012 at the Wheaton College Bob Batista Invitational.


MILESTONE WATCH

  • Senior Defender Jamie Tausend is tied for seventh with 12 assists on the Carthage career assists list.

  • Tausend is also 14 starts shy of having the most starts by a Carthage player, a record currently held by Max Zbilut (74 starts).

  • Rimkus’s 17 goals is two shy of taking the sole eighth spot on the all time careers list, which is held by Brian Santella, who has 18 goals.

  • Mavrogiannis ranks 9th all time on the career saves list with 43.

  • Justiniano ranks 7th all time on the career saves list with 58.


THINGS TO KNOW

  • Carthage is ranked No. 22 in the preseason varsity poll organized by the United Soccer Coaches. The Red Men were also voted No. 1 in the College Conference of Illinois and Wisconsin preseason poll.

  • Head coach Steve Domin is in his 22nd season as Carthage men’s soccer head coach. Domin holds an overall record of 219-159-35 in his tenure as head coach.

  • The 2017 team captains are seniors Tausend and Rimkus, and juniors Mahoney and Herrera.

  • In addition to Rimkus and Tausend, the 2017 season features a senior class of Erik Boese, Joey Klawitter, and Sahr Mahoney
